The dating website WhatsYourPrice.com conducted an informal survey of 41,000 people and found that 64 percent of women thought about getting back together with an ex after hearing the emotional ballad. However, the guys felt a little differently—only 17 percent of men surveyed said the song made them thirsty for a romantic #TBT.
